Since my first post wound up being a bug report, and was appropriately diverted, I'm starting this one for all those other questions that bounce around in my head as I explore Silgrad.

1. How much new armor and clothing is there? The pirates on the way over had a bunch of new gear, but I haven't seen much of anything out of the ordinary in my travels, apart from a broken fur cloak and the assassin's hood. Weapons, too... Only departures from normalcy I've seen since my arrival have been the heavy and enhanced models.

2. Where's all the wildlife? I've run into a handful of alits and nix hounds, and two swamp racers, plus a few faeries, shalks, and a wasp or two. Now, I may be spoiled, after having downloaded a creature expansion, but I've run across a good bit of wilderness and seen a lot of archers and hunters with not much to hunt besides guar. Oh, and durzog in the mountains, but only two of them. Wildlife seems to be very rare, unless it's a fish, in which case bring on the slaughter.

3. On a related note, I can't find a mammoth shalk anywhere.

4. How many smuggler's dens are there, compared to Vardenfell? Apart from the slavers in Ebedeen, I've only found one.

Thiers actually many new (in 2003 when it was released) armors in silgrad, durzog, dibilla, kynareth, gold plate and a number of varieties of glass, chitin, and bonemold...but many of these items were added long ago, we have not made any new armors or weapons for silgrad.

I felt the same when I first started playing silgrad, but then I discovered most of the wildlife seen in Vvardenfell is indigenous to Vvardenfell, thats why you won't see much of them. But yes I agree its a bit barren of creatures, we have added some others and PirateLord has given us use of his creatures mod

4. How many smuggler's dens are there, compared to Vardenfell? Apart from the slavers in Ebedeen, I've only found one.

Good question I think 4 are actually designated as smugglers hideouts, theirs a total of 61 npc's that are smugglers so their quite a bit of smuggling going on, alot of them have to do with the Legio Argonis Questing which is not included in the 1-4_3 version and has not been incorporated into the newer version either, but will be, someday, I hope Smile
